    It depends on your budget. But the Gloomis GLX jig worm rod in the 6'8" med-hvy is hard to beat. It is the lightest most sensitive and resposive rod I have ever used. Just depends on what you want to spend. Someone mention the Allstar and its a great rod also. I guess the point is this. All of the rod brands that have been mentioned are good. See if you know anyone with any of the rods your interested in and see if they will let you try them out. Cast and pitch with it and see how it feels in your hands. I may tell you to go with a loomis but an H&H might feel better to you. So try to handle some of the rods and most important. Go with one that has a lifetime warranty.
